Yesterday the awards of the judges in the skill competitions held at the Shoe and Leather Fair were announced. Local winners:-
Patterns cut to lasts.The first prize (£2) and second prize (25/0) were divided between Mr. Mapp, 76 Park-lane, London, and Mr. W. Goode, 16 Essex-road, Rushden, each of whom will receive £1/12/6 and diploma.
Pattern grading.First prize (£2) and diploma, Mr. W. Billing, Burton Latimer; second prize (25/0) and certificate, Mr. W. Goode, Rushden. Certificate, Mr. A. Clifton, 8 Irchester-road, Rushden.
Taking measurements.First prize (£3) and diploma, Mr. W. Goode, Rushden; second (£1/10/0/) and certificate, Mr. H. E. Dickenson, Manton-street, Irthlingboro’. Hon. mention, Mr. W. C. Tarry, of 61 Portland-road, Rushden.
Graded patterns.First prize (£2) and diploma, Mr. H. J. Garner, Leicester; second (25/0) and certificate, Mr. A. Clifton, Irchester-road, Rushden.
